Webretirement, this is known as a qualifying life event (QLE). In most cases a QLE opens a 90-day window for you to make changes to your existing TRICARE plan outside of TRICARE’s Open Season. Following major life events, such as the ones listed above, be sure to update your record in the Defense Enrollment Eligibility Reporting System or DEERS.
